Hi Giles, This is exactly how it works, you add a record to /etc/hosts file, that could be any record. There's only one confusing step -- you need to restart dnsmasq every time you edit the file as dnsmasq doesn't detect changes automatically. Alex. On 13/11/15 07:55 PM, Giles Orr wrote:
Is there a way (using just DNSmasq, not installing a full service DNS server) to have an OpenWRT router answer DNS queries for a particular name? A name that's not a local DHCP lease. I have a Digital Ocean "droplet" that's just an IP, but I've given it a name and normally stuff that name and the IP into the /etc/hosts file. But if I put it into the router, I wouldn't have to keep editing hosts files ...
